[发明专利]一种云电子医疗数据加密系统在审

专利信息
申请号: 202010685571.9 申请日: 2020-07-16
公开(公告)号: CN111865965A 公开(公告)日: 2020-10-30
发明(设计)人: 董海霞 申请(专利权)人: 董海霞
主分类号: H04L29/06 分类号: H04L29/06;H04L29/08;G06F21/60;G06F21/62
代理公司: 合肥左心专利代理事务所(普通合伙) 34152 代理人: 潘华
地址: 038500 山西*** 国省代码: 山西;14
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 一种 电子 医疗 数据 加密 系统
【说明书】:

发明涉及云电子医疗数据加密技术领域,且公开了一种云电子医疗数据加密系统,包括:运行有医疗数据加密系统软件的云数据服务器CDSDS、云授权服务器CASK、用于对电子医疗数据读操作进行授权的计算机终端PCTDO、用于对电子医疗数据写操作进行授权的计算机终端PCTDM、用于读取电子医疗数据的计算机终端PCTDR;存储在云数据服务器CDSDS上的电子医疗数据只有经过具有读操作权限的计算机终端PCTDM的可读性授权,才允许计算机终端PCTDR上的用户ui解密密文,并且使得存储在云数据服务器CDSDS上的电子医疗数据只有具有写操作权限的计算机终端PCTDM才能进行修改。本发明解决了目前在确保云电子医疗数据隐私的前提下,无法保证数据真实性的技术问题。

技术领域

本发明涉及云电子医疗数据加密技术领域,具体为一种云电子医疗数据加密系统。

背景技术

随着云计算的广泛应用,将个人健康记录(PHR)数据外包给第三方服务供应商,然后由病人完全控制数据的访问授权,已经成为一种趋势。PHR服务的主要思想是,每个病人可以远程修改和管理自己的个人健康信息,从而使得个人健康数据的存储、检索和共享更加有效。为了提供隐私保护,病人可以完全控制自己的电子医疗记录(EMR)数据的访问权限,并仅与合法用户共享个人健康信息。一般来说,为了更好地治疗疾病和监测健康状况,病人会与自己的主治医生,家庭成员以及亲密朋友共享个人健康记录信息。

虽然PHR服务可以通过以病人为中心的模式交换病人健康信息以造福患者,但PHR系统存在一个应用缺陷,即允许数据拥有者任意修改数据,导致数据真实性无法保证。

发明内容

(一)解决的技术问题

针对现有技术的不足,本发明提供一种云电子医疗数据加密系统,以解决目前在确保云电子医疗数据隐私的前提下,无法保证数据真实性的技术问题。

(二)技术方案

为实现上述目的,本发明提供如下技术方案:

一种云电子医疗数据加密系统,包括:运行有医疗数据加密系统软件的云数据服务器CDSDS、云授权服务器CASK、用于对电子医疗数据读操作进行授权的计算机终端PCTDO、用于对电子医疗数据写操作进行授权的计算机终端PCTDM、用于读取电子医疗数据的计算机终端PCTDR

云授权服务器CASK分别与计算机终端PCTDO和计算机终端PCTDM进行通信连接;计算机终端PCTDO和计算机终端PCTDM均与云数据服务器CDSDS进行通信连接;云数据服务器CDSDS与计算机终端PCTDR进行通信连接;

上述医疗数据加密系统的加密方法,具体包括以下步骤:

步骤一:云授权服务器CASK进行参数设置:令n=pq,φ(n)=(p-1)(q-1),其中p≠q都是素数,选择e,d,满足ed≡1modφ(n),公钥PK={e,n},私钥SK={d,n};

云授权服务器CASK随机选取ei1、ei2,且ei1ei2≡emodφ(n),将ei1发送给计算机终端PCTDM,将ei2发送给云数据服务器CDSDS

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于董海霞,未经董海霞许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/202010685571.9/2.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top